FOUNDATIONS FOR A BETTER OREGON, founded in 2003, is a community nonprofit in the Education sector that reported $1.2M in total revenue in fiscal year 2024. Revenue surged 52% from the prior year, signaling strong growth momentum. Expenses of $1.5M exceeded revenue, resulting in a 21% operating deficit.

Mission

FBO ADVANCES OREGON'S COMMITMENT TO SUPPORT EVERY CHILD TO LEARN, GROW, AND THRIVE. WE BRIDGE COMMUNITY, POLICYMAKERS, AND PHILANTHROPY TO COLLABORATE TOWARD REALIZING A SHARED LONG-TERM VISION FOR OUR CHILDREN AND YOUNG PEOPLE.

POLICY & ADVOCACY - WORKING PRIMARILY AT THE STATE LEVEL, WE COLLABORATE WITH IMPACTED COMMUNITIES THROUGHOUT THE STATE TO ANALYZE, DEVELOP, AND ADVOCATE FOR POLICY CHANGES AND PUBLIC INVESTMENTS THAT CREATE A BETTER OREGON FOR EVERY CHILD. WE BELIEVE PUBLIC SYSTEMS WORK BEST WHEN IMPACTED COMMUNITIES ENGAGE IN THE ENTIRE CYCLE OF CHANGE, FROM PROBLEM IDENTIFICATION TO POLICY DESIGN TO ACCOUNTABILITY.

COMMUNITY PARTNER SUPPORT - ENGAGING MULTIPLE PERSPECTIVES AND EXAMINING ISSUES FROM DIFFERENT VANTAGE POINTS ARE CRITICAL TO DRIVING COLLECTIVE ACTION. THROUGH OREGON PARTNERS FOR EDUCATION JUSTICE, WE CONVENE OREGONIANS TO FORM A STATEWIDE NETWORK OF COMMUNITY-BASED ORGANIZATIONS, CULTURALLY SPECIFIC SERVICE PROVIDERS, AND EDUCATION ADVOCATES WHO ARE CHAMPIONING A RACIALLY JUST AND COMMUNITY-CENTERED EDUCATION SYSTEM, AND ALSO WORK TO SUPPORT A BROAD RANGE OF PARTNERS ACROSS OREGON.
